N-UNCOUNT If you do something in remembrance of a dead person, you do it as a way of showing that you want to remember them and that you respect them. 紀(jì)唸; 懷唸[正式] They wore black in remembrance of those who had died. 他們穿一身黑服以紀(jì)唸死者。 返回 remembrance劍橋詞典[ 不可數(shù)或單數(shù)名詞:沒有複數(shù)形式的名詞 ] the act of remembering and showing respect for someone who has died or a past event 紀(jì)唸;懷唸;緬懷 A church service was held in remembrance of the victims . 在教堂擧行了一次紀(jì)唸受害者們的禮拜儀式。 [ 可數(shù)名詞:有複數(shù)形式的名詞 通常作爲(wèi)複數(shù)使用的名詞 ] a memory of something that happened in the past 記憶;廻憶 fond /sweet /personal remembrances 深情的/甜蜜的/個(gè)人的廻憶 返回 remembrance
